A leading construction company in the UK is looking for a Civil Engineer to oversee project implementation, manage budgets, and mentor junior engineers.
Candidates must hold a degree in Civil Engineering and have experience with Eurocodes and technical design.
The role includes a variety of benefits like a 24/7 digital GP service and enhanced family benefits.
Short-term assignments across various UK locations may be required.

How to prepare for a job interview at Skanska UK PLC
✨Know Your Eurocodes
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Eurocodes before the interview. Be prepared to discuss how you've applied them in past projects, as this will show your technical expertise and understanding of industry standards.
✨Showcase Your Project Management Skills
Since the role involves overseeing project implementation and managing budgets, come ready with examples of projects you've led. Highlight your ability to manage timelines and resources effectively, as well as any challenges you overcame.
✨Mentorship Matters
As mentoring junior engineers is a key part of the job, think about your approach to mentorship. Prepare to share specific instances where you've guided or supported less experienced colleagues, demonstrating your leadership style and commitment to team development.
✨Be Ready for Flexibility
With short-term assignments across various UK locations, it's important to express your willingness to travel and adapt. Share any relevant experiences that showcase your flexibility and readiness to take on new challenges in different environments.
